Honey Granola Breakfast Bars
Honey Granola Breakfast Bars

Prep Time:
20 minutes
Cook Time:
20 minutes
Total Time:
45 minutes
Wholesome honey granola bars loaded with oats, wheat germ, dried fruit, and walnuts - perfect for a satisfying breakfast or snack!
Ingredients:
  • 2 cups old-fashioned oats
  • 1 cup chopped walnuts
  • 0.75 cup brown sugar
  • 0.75 cup dried fruit
  • 0.5 cup all-purpose flour
  • 0.5 cup whole wheat flour
  • 0.5 cup toasted wheat germ
  • 0.75 teaspoon ground cinnamon
  • 0.75 teaspoon salt
  • 0.5 cup vegetable oil
  • 0.5 cup honey
  • 2 teaspoons vanilla extract
Instructions:
  •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C) and prepare a 9x13-inch baking dish or jelly roll pan by lining it with parchment paper.
  • Combine the oats, walnuts, brown sugar, dried fruit, all-purpose flour, whole wheat flour, wheat germ, cinnamon, and salt in a bowl.
  • Combine oil, honey, egg, and vanilla extract in a separate bowl, then mix into oats until just combined. Spread the batter in the prepared baking dish.
  • Bake in a preheated oven until the edges turn golden brown, which should take around 20 to 25 minutes. Let it cool slightly on a wire rack, then slice into 12 bars while still warm with a pizza cutter.
